Marechale Capital Plc is listed in the Investment Advice s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ker MAC. The last closing price for Marechale Capital was 1.05p. Over the last year, Marechale Capital shares have traded in a share price range of 1.05p to 2.30p.

Marechale Capital currently has 105,899,581 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Marechale Capital is £1.11 million. Marechale Capital has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-2.63.
